摘要
利用CPO技术设计了在掺铒光纤中实现光速的连续可调的实验.实验系统中利用LabVIEW和FPGA设计的信号发生器对激光信号进行内调制,信号经过掺铒光纤由数据采集卡传递到上位机,利用LabVIEW进行分析和处理.该系统可以简化数据分析过程,实现人机交互,便于实时监测分析.
An experimental system which could adjust the velocity of light continuously was proposed.Using LabVIEW and FPGA,signal generator could modulate light signal,and the signal passing through Erbium-doped fiber could be collected by DAQ,then transferred to PC and processed by LabVIEW.The system could simplify the data analysis process,achieve human-computer interaction and facilitate real-time monitoring.
